Prometheus response error

Summary

Checking the Kubernetes and Serverless Operations pages of the triage-serverless project gives a Prometheus error.

Steps to reproduce

  • navigate to the above pages

Example Project

https://gitlab.com/gitlab-org/quality/triage-serverless

What is the current bug behavior?

Kubernetes is set up, with Prometheus installed. Still, the environments page does not find it.
